Fees and Cost Over Time
AINT charges 1.25% per year while VYM charges 0.04%. On a $10,000 position that is $125 vs $4 annually, a gap of $121 per year that compounds over a long holding period. On income, AINT currently yields 0.00% against 2.24% for VYM.
Holdings Overlap
At least 0.9% of VYM's money is in holdings AINT also owns.
Only one direction is shown: for AINT, our book for it lists positions totalling 116.6% of the fund, which is what a leveraged book looks like and is not a denominator we can divide by.
We cannot see either book well enough to say how much of this pair is duplicated.
The two holdings books were reported 56 days apart, AINT as of Aug 25, 2026 and VYM as of Jun 30, 2026, so some of the difference between them is the time between the two reports rather than the funds.
5 positions in common, counted across the 23 positions we hold weights for in AINT and 603 in VYM, against full books of 22 and 613.
